💬What is Wood Block Puzzle?

Wood Block Puzzle doesn't waste time with timers or explosions. It's just you, an empty 10x10 grid, and a queue of wooden shapes. Drag a block onto the board, fill a row or column to clear it, and keep going until there's no room left. Sounds simple. Then you get that L-shaped piece and realize you've left three gaps no block can fill. The thing that got me hooked is the quiet pressure. There's no countdown, but every move matters because you don't know what shapes are coming next. I remember a run where I nearly filled the board with only a 2x2 hole left, and then three straight long bars showed up. That's the game's sense of humor. You start planning squares and straight lines, but the random queue keeps throwing weird nails at you. Some players try to keep the board as flat as possible; others build around a corner. Neither strategy is foolproof. You'll want to leave open spaces for both horizontal and vertical clears. If you fill only rows, columns get clogged. And if you save your larger blocks for emergencies, you might run out of space holding them. The game resets only when you can't place a single piece, so a board that looks doomed can still be saved with one clever fit. It's the kind of puzzle that feels meditative for three minutes, then suddenly turns into a frantic Tetris cousin without the falling speed. Perfect for a quick break, but don't be surprised if you look up and realize an hour vanished.

Game Tips

Keep a 4x4 empty zone near a corner for late-game big squares. Always clear at least one line every three moves to avoid clutter. Don't fill the center first; edges and corners are easier to work around. Save the single-cell block for emergencies. Watch the next piece preview before placing the current one. If you get three long bars in a row, build a vertical shaft instead of fighting them.
